§ 31A-23a-1007 — Adjudicative proceedings -- Review -- Coordination with department.

Utah·Title 31A Insurance Code·Ch. 31A-23a Insurance Marketing - Licensing Producers, Consultants, and Reinsurance Intermediaries·Part 31A-23a-10 Affiliated Business in Title Insurance
(1)(1)(a) Before an action described in Section 31A-23a-1006 may be taken, the division shall:
(1)(a)(i) give notice to the person against whom the action is brought; and
(1)(a)(ii) commence an adjudicative proceeding.
(1)(b) If after the adjudicative proceeding is commenced under Subsection (1)(a) the presiding officer determines that a title entity has violated a provision of this part, including Section 8 of RESPA, the division may take an action described in Section 31A-23a-1006 by written order.
(2)In accordance with Title 63G, Chapter 4, Administrative Procedures Act, a person against whom action is taken under this part may seek review of the action by the executive director of the Department of Commerce.
